  • Ground beef sold at Walmart recalled over E. coli concerns

    Consumers who recently purchased ground beef at Walmart need to check the labels. The Department of Agriculture on Wednesday issued a "High-Class 1" alert warning that more than 16,000 pounds of beef shipped to the retail giant nationwide is being recalled over concerns that it could be contaminated with E. coli.
